Output 0ca68c3ae031bb9149febeabb0ffa6e586b5e8604211b30f130cb5af1754f325:62

value
4405435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d640ae94255a77e9b65767d2173a9df9b64c8116 OP_EQUAL
address
3MDt1mxijGSkR5uXfUQZ8gLLLK1uhMBJX1
transaction
0ca68c3ae031bb9149febeabb0ffa6e586b5e8604211b30f130cb5af1754f325
spent
true